Shoe Hunting

The truth is I have gained weight a lot since return back to Jordan. So I have planned to lose some weight before the upcoming holiday. 

To do so, I must have running shoe so that I could excercise outdoor. I had left my running shoe at home in Malaysia during the last season break.

Today, I went to Baladiah Irbid (City of Irbid) to browse some musta'mal (used) shoe. I did not remember that today was Jordan public holiday and the street was flooded by human. 



The hallway does not seem bussy, but I swear each stall was fulled by people. Everyone was so eager grabbing used item that had been offered with really low price. If you passion enough, you could find nice and new-looked stuff there. 
You must be surprised to find a Zara, GAP, H&M, Nike, Dr Marten and more branded item in the street market.

Well, I did found myself a leather shoe that cost only 5Jd. I guess I could wear it as much as I want. Even for running. Worth every cent. I hope. Haha.



After return back home, I planned to go jog after Asar but unfortunately there was a sudden rain and mud everywhere. So, I have to cancelled my plan and stay home studying.

Clinical Group 5


How is your day in dental clinic?
Who surronds you?

Basically, as a dental students, you must be paired up working in the clinic.
One act as the operator, and the other as assistant. 

Me and my partner in crime, Dr Abdullah Anas. Random photo after finished Peadiatric Clinic with his patient, Lujain.

As much exhausted as being an operator for one clinic, being an assistant for that clinic was collapsing. People said that, doing nothing is more tiring than doing something and being an assistant literrally looking/starring at patients 24/7 while holding suction hose. Haha.

Emotional scenes with the workers in dispensary were our daily routine, plus sometimes the Dorctor who assist us doing treadment on that day, give us more headache with the unsatisfactory marks.
Up until now, I am still trying to catch things up with the situation, timing for each treatment and in dealing with different kind of patients. Addition to the examination for the whole December, adapting to the hectic life as dental student surely tough.

Apart from that, I am still grateful and so blessed to be surrounded by people who are kind and really helpful.
I could say that, my life are going to be thounsand times more miserable without my groupmates. *hug*

My First Real Pt

I did my final visit of Root Canal Treatment (RCT) almost one week ago but the experience i had is still vivid like it was performed yesterday.

Consider that was my very first treatment on real patient, the time management was not that good. But i believe that through mistakes i can be better. Not that i am encouraging the "wall" to make mistakes, yet minimise it by any chance.

I would like to share my story doing tretment in clinic with my patient in future.
But for now, let me intoduce my first patient, his name is Yazan. At glance i saw him as troublemaker, but through each visit, i saw his passion getting his teeth done. He was very cooperative and punctual at each visit. I was blessed to have him as my first real patient. 
Thanks to him that the RCT was done and considerably great. 

I did root canal treatment on upper right premolar with 2 canals and finished with disto-occlusal composite restoration.
